Exelixis, Inc. announced today that thirteen abstracts related to the company's development candidates have been accepted for presentation at the 2009 AACR-NCI-EORTC International Conference on Molecular Targets and Cancer Therapeutics, which is being held November 15-19 in Boston. Interim data from ongoing phase 1 clinical trials of XL147 and XL765 will be reported in four poster presentations.

"As the world heads into the fourth decade of AIDS, it is finally in a position to end the epidemic, [U.N.] Secretary-General Ban Ki-moon said [Thursday], leading a chorus of United Nations officials in calling for the political will, investments and determination to reach this goal," the U.N. News Centre reports. "'Momentum is on our side. Let us use it to end AIDS - once and for all,' Mr. Ban said in his message for World AIDS Day," the news service writes.
